Friday, February 12, 1904 Volume XXXVIII, Number 7 Joseph Lynn Joseph Lynn, a young miner well-known in the north of the county, having been secretary of the union at Nant-y-Glo died at that place Thursday morning of last week after a brief illness from brain fever. He had been working at Barnesboro for some time and went to Nant-y- Glo, it is said, to call upon a young lady to whom he was to have been married it the spring. The body was taken to Loretto where services were held after which interment was made at Tunnelhill.
